Payment System Efficiency

Efficiency

Payment System Efficiency, within the context of cryptocurrency, options trading, and financial derivatives, fundamentally concerns the minimization of operational costs and latency while maximizing throughput and reliability. This encompasses aspects like transaction finality, gas fees in blockchain networks, and the speed of order execution on exchanges. Achieving optimal efficiency necessitates a holistic approach, considering factors from cryptographic protocols to market microstructure design, ultimately impacting capital allocation and trading strategy effectiveness. The pursuit of enhanced efficiency is a continuous process, driven by technological advancements and evolving regulatory landscapes.
